首页
/ 零基础掌握工具本地化:让软件秒变母语模式的效率指南

零基础掌握工具本地化:让软件秒变母语模式的效率指南

2026-04-27 13:28:29作者:明树来

在全球化协作与跨文化开发的场景中,软件工具的本地化设置(Localization Settings)已成为提升工作效率的关键环节。当开发界面充斥着陌生术语,每次操作都需要查阅词典时,不仅打断思维连贯性,更会累积大量隐形时间成本。本文将以Android Studio为例,系统讲解如何通过本地化配置方法将开发环境转换为母语模式,让工具真正成为生产力助手而非障碍。

一、环境准备:获取本地化资源包

本地化设置的第一步是准备适用于目标软件的语言资源。Android Studio作为基于IntelliJ平台的IDE,其本地化支持依赖于语言扩展包的正确部署。

  1. 克隆资源仓库
    打开终端执行以下命令获取官方维护的中文语言包:

    git clone https://gitcode.com/gh_mirrors/an/AndroidStudioChineseLanguagePack
    

    ⚠️ 风险提示:确保网络连接稳定,仓库克隆失败会导致后续安装无资源可用。

  2. 验证文件完整性
    进入下载目录,确认images文件夹及语言包JAR文件存在。成功获取的资源包应包含完整的插件元数据和界面截图资源。

二、扩展安装:部署本地化插件

Android Studio采用插件化架构实现功能扩展,本地化语言包通过插件系统生效,安装过程需注意版本兼容性。

  1. 启动插件管理界面
    打开Android Studio,通过菜单栏 文件 → 设置(快捷键Ctrl+Alt+S)进入配置面板,在左侧导航栏选择 插件 选项。

  2. 从磁盘安装插件
    点击插件面板右上角的设置图标,选择 从磁盘安装插件 选项,浏览至克隆仓库中的JAR文件并确认安装。

    Android Studio插件安装界面

    ✅ 成功标识:插件列表中出现"Chinese (Simplified)"且状态为"已启用"。

  3. 重启IDE使插件生效
    安装完成后会提示重启Android Studio,此时需保存所有打开项目,确保配置正确加载。

三、语言配置:完成本地化切换

插件安装后需通过系统设置指定界面语言,这一步决定了本地化效果的最终呈现。

  1. 进入语言设置面板
    欢迎界面点击 自定义 → 语言和区域,或在IDE内通过 文件 → 设置 → 外观与行为 → 系统设置 → Language and Region 进入配置页。

  2. 选择目标语言
    在语言下拉菜单中选择"Chinese",区域设置保持默认即可。设置变更会触发重启提示。

    Android Studio语言设置界面

    ⚠️ 风险提示:错误的区域设置可能导致日期格式、数字分隔符等系统组件显示异常。

  3. 确认语言切换
    点击"确定"后IDE将自动重启,再次启动时所有界面元素将使用新选择的语言。

四、效果验证:检查本地化完整性

完成配置后需从整体界面到细节功能进行全面验证,确保本地化覆盖无遗漏。

  1. 验证欢迎界面本地化
    重启后观察欢迎界面,所有菜单选项如"新建项目"、"打开"等应显示为中文。

    Android Studio中文欢迎界面

  2. 检查编辑器环境本地化
    创建测试项目,验证代码提示、右键菜单、重构选项等开发核心功能的语言转换效果。

    Android Studio中文编辑界面

  3. 跨版本兼容性测试

    功能模块 英文界面 中文界面 兼容性状态
    项目创建向导 New Project 新建项目 ✅ 完全兼容
    代码分析工具 Code Analysis 代码分析 ✅ 完全兼容
    构建错误提示 Build Error 构建错误 ✅ 完全兼容
    快捷键说明 Keyboard Shortcuts 键盘快捷键 ✅ 部分术语保留英文

五、问题解决:本地化故障排除

即使按步骤操作,仍可能遇到各类本地化问题,以下是常见场景的解决方案。

5.1 本地化失效应急方案

当语言切换后界面无变化时:

  1. 检查插件是否被禁用:设置 → 插件 → 已安装 确认中文语言包状态
  2. 清除缓存重启:文件 → 使缓存失效/重启 强制重新加载资源
  3. 手动验证配置文件:检查config/options/language.xml中是否存在<option name="userLocale" value="zh-CN"/>

5.2 常见错误处理

  • 部分菜单未翻译:这是正常现象,专业术语通常保留英文以确保准确性
  • 界面乱码:检查系统字体是否支持中文,建议安装"Microsoft YaHei UI"等兼容字体
  • 版本不匹配:通过插件市场查看语言包支持的IDE版本范围,降级或升级IDE至兼容版本

附录:本地化常见术语对照表

英文术语 中文翻译 应用场景
Localization 本地化 整体语言环境配置
Plugin 插件 扩展功能模块
Restart 重启 使配置生效的操作
Compatibility 兼容性 版本匹配要求
Cache 缓存 影响资源加载的临时数据

通过本文介绍的本地化配置流程,即使是零基础用户也能在5分钟内完成Android Studio的语言环境转换。当开发工具以熟悉的母语呈现时,不仅能降低学习门槛,更能让注意力聚焦于代码逻辑本身。记住,工具应当适应人,而非人适应工具——这正是本地化设置的核心价值所在。

登录后查看全文
热门项目推荐
相关项目推荐

项目优选

收起
atomcodeatomcode
Claude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get Started
Rust
447
80
docsdocs
暂无描述
Dockerfile
691
4.48 K
kernelkernel
openEuler内核是openEuler操作系统的核心,既是系统性能与稳定性的基石,也是连接处理器、设备与服务的桥梁。
C
408
328
pytorchpytorch
Ascend Extension for PyTorch
Python
550
673
kernelkernel
deepin linux kernel
C
28
16
RuoYi-Vue3RuoYi-Vue3
🎉 (RuoYi)官方仓库 基于SpringBoot,Spring Security,JWT,Vue3 & Vite、Element Plus 的前后端分离权限管理系统
Vue
1.59 K
930
ops-mathops-math
本项目是CANN提供的数学类基础计算算子库,实现网络在NPU上加速计算。
C++
955
931
communitycommunity
本项目是CANN开源社区的核心管理仓库,包含社区的治理章程、治理组织、通用操作指引及流程规范等基础信息
652
232
openHiTLSopenHiTLS
旨在打造算法先进、性能卓越、高效敏捷、安全可靠的密码套件,通过轻量级、可剪裁的软件技术架构满足各行业不同场景的多样化要求,让密码技术应用更简单,同时探索后量子等先进算法创新实践,构建密码前沿技术底座!
C
1.08 K
564
Cangjie-ExamplesCangjie-Examples
本仓将收集和展示高质量的仓颉示例代码,欢迎大家投稿,让全世界看到您的妙趣设计,也让更多人通过您的编码理解和喜爱仓颉语言。
C
436
4.43 K